Peter W. Heck resides in Kokomo, IN with his wife Jenny, and their daughters, Addison and Bristol.  For a brief biographical sketch that can be used for speaking introductions, click here.
 
Peter graduated cum laude from Indiana Wesleyan University in 2001 with a Bachelor of Science in both Social Studies Education and Political Science. Then after compiling a perfect academic record, he earned his Masters in Political Science from Ball State University in 2007.
 
Peter has been a public high school teacher since the fall of 2001, teaching courses in American government and American history. In 2005 he was named the Veterans of Foreign Wars Regional Teacher of the Year, and was the state runner-up. In 2008 he was named the General James A. Cox Daughters of the American Revolution District Teacher of the Year for outstanding contributions to secondary education.
 
Besides his teaching career, Peter is an increasingly sought-after public speaker. He has been the featured and keynote speaker at numerous events. His three 4-part series, America’s Foundation of Faith, Pillars of the Faith and A Christian Response to the Unmentionables, have been presented at churches throughout the country.
 
The Peter Heck Radio Show debuted in the summer of 2004 on 1350 AM, WIOU Kokomo which still serves as the program’s flagship station. The show, broadcast from central Indiana, is archived on the internet every weekday immediately following each show.  The program's weekly highlights podcast is followed around the United States. Peter has been heard on nearly 200 radio stations in the country courtesy of American Family Radio Network.
 
Peter Heck is also an opinion columnist, published both online and in several papers.  His work appears regularly on nationally and internationally read websites like The American Thinker, OneNewsNow, and has also been featured on others like FrontPageMag, and WorldNetDaily.  Having been featured on nationally syndicated radio programs like The Mark Levin Show and having been distributed by the Family Research Council and the American Family Association, Peter’s columns have been read by millions across the country and world.
 
Peter maintained membership in two professional honor societies: Pi Gamma Mu (political science honor society) and Kappa Delta Pi (educational honor society).
